How they compare

Iceland currently reports 0.0022 kt against 0.002 kt in Nepal, a difference of 0.0002 kt.

That makes Iceland's figure about 1.1 times Nepal's.

Across all 34 years both countries report, Iceland has been ahead every year.

Iceland ranks 77th and Nepal ranks 78th of 153 countries.

Iceland has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
